Ingredients Breakdown

The ingredients in this soup come together to create a harmonious balance of flavors and textures. Butter adds richness and forms the base of the roux, which thickens the soup. All-purpose flour works alongside the butter to create a smooth and creamy consistency. Finely chopped onion, diced carrots, and celery contribute a savory depth, while broccoli provides a hearty and nutritious element that takes center stage.

Vegetable or chicken broth adds the foundational flavor and can be adjusted for dietary preferences. Whole milk or heavy cream enhances the soup’s velvety texture, while shredded cheddar cheese lends a bold, cheesy richness. Salt and pepper tie the flavors together, while optional grated Parmesan offers an extra layer of indulgence. For substitutions, plant-based milk and cheese can create a vegan version, and Gruyère or smoked cheddar can add a unique twist to the flavor profile.

Step-by-Step Instructions

Begin by preparing the vegetables. Sautéing onion, carrots, and celery in butter not only softens them but also brings out their natural sweetness, creating a flavorful base for the soup. Adding the broccoli florets allows them to absorb the savory foundation, enhancing their flavor before the broth is added.

Making the roux is a critical step to ensure the soup achieves its creamy consistency. Melt additional butter in the center of the pot, then mix in the flour, stirring continuously. This step forms the thickening agent that will give the soup its luxurious texture.

Gradually adding the broth prevents lumps from forming, creating a smooth, cohesive base. Stir thoroughly as you pour in the liquid, and increase the heat to bring the mixture to a gentle boil, allowing it to thicken naturally.

Once the broth is incorporated, slowly pour in the milk or cream. Stir gently but consistently to achieve a creamy and smooth soup base. Maintaining low heat at this stage prevents curdling, ensuring the soup retains its velvety texture.

Letting the soup simmer gives the broccoli time to soften while allowing the flavors to meld beautifully.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king. When the broccoli reaches the desired tenderness, add the shredded cheddar cheese, stirring until it melts completely into the soup. This step adds a rich, cheesy finish to the dish. Ad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per to taste.

Recipe Tips

Stir frequently to keep the milk or cream from curdling during cooking.

For a smoother soup, purée part of the mixture with an immersion blender before adding the cheese.

Add a pinch of nutmeg to subtly enhance the creamy profile.

Store leftovers in the refrigerator in an airtight container for up to three days, or freeze for longer storage. Reheat gently to maintain the creamy consistency.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this soup vegan?
Yes, simply substitute almond or oat milk for dairy milk, olive oil for butter, and plant-based cheese for cheddar.

How do I prevent the milk from curdling?
Use low heat when adding milk and stir continuously. Avoid boiling the soup after the milk is incorporated.

Can I use frozen broccoli?
Absolutely! Just adjust the cooking time, as frozen broccoli tends to cook faster than fresh florets.

Broccoli and Vegetable Soup Recipe

Ingredients

2 cups whole milk or heavy cream
3 cups vegetable or chicken broth
2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 small onion, finely chopped
2 cups broccoli florets
1 cup diced carrots
1 cup diced celery
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
Salt and pepper, to taste
Optional: grated Parmesan for garnish

Instructions

Prepare the Vegetables: In a medium-sized pot,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the finely chopped onion, diced carrots, and celery. Sauté the vegetables for about 5 minutes, or until they soften and release their aromatic flavors. Stir in the broccoli florets and cook for an additional 2 minutes, allowing them to absorb the savory base.

Make the Roux: Push the sautéed vegetables to the edges of the pot, creating a space in the center. Melt the remaining butter in the middle, then sprinkle in the flour. Stir continuously for 1 minute to create a roux, which will act as a thickening agent for the soup.

Add Broth: Gradually pour in the vegetable or chicken broth, stirring constantly to ensure the roux dissolves evenly without forming lumps. Increase the heat slightly and bring the soup to a gentle boil, allowing it to thicken.

Add Milk: Reduce the heat to low and slowly pour in the whole milk or heavy cream. Stir thoroughly to achieve a smooth, creamy consistency.

Cook the Broccoli: Let the soup simmer gently for 10–15 minutes, giving the broccoli time to soften and the flavors to meld beautifully.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king.

Add Cheese: Once the broccoli is tender, sprinkle in the shredded cheddar cheese. Stir until the cheese has melted completely, creating a rich and velvety soup. Ad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per according to your taste.

Serve: Ladle the soup into bowls and, if desired, garnish with freshly grated Parmesan for an extra layer of flavor. Serve the soup piping hot with crusty bread or your favorite crackers for a comforting and satisfying meal.
